Structure of the thermo-sensitive TRP channel TRP1 from the alga Chlamydomonas reinhardtii

Algae produce the largest amount of oxygen on earth and are invaluable for human nutrition and biomedicine, as well as for the chemical industry, energy production and agriculture.
